Tilebarrow cache layer — quick recovery steps. If hit rate drops below 70%, check the warmer job first; it flakes after region failovers. Restart the warmer, then flush only the zoom-14+ keys (full flushes hammer the renderers, don't do it). Confirm latency recovers within ten minutes. Note the build you touched below.

trace token, fafog-kageg: htk4_98e6

# Env file — Cartwheel dispatch, driver-assignment heuristic
# Scope: staging only. Do not promote to prod.
# The heuristic weights (proximity, shift balance, refusal rate) are tuned
# for the Velmont pilot region and will misbehave elsewhere.
# Review notes: heuristic service runs unprivileged; it reads weights
# read-only from the tuning store and writes nothing back.
# Only one sensitive value exists in this file: the tuning-store access
# credential, consumed at boot and never logged.
# That credential is set on the following line.

secret setting of faduf-bahop: LEDGER_TOKEN8=c3b363be

## Formula sandbox tuning

User-supplied formulas in Gridmoor execute inside a restricted interpreter with hard ceilings on time, memory, and call depth. Reviewers should confirm any change to these ceilings is justified in the PR description, since raising them widens the abuse surface. Defaults were chosen from production traces. The current limits are as follows.

limits module of tafog-fawip:
WEIGHTS = {
    "julix": 57,
    "lamys": 992,
    "kasvan": 209,
    "quenok": 750,
    "alddor": 259,
    "oliath": 1009,
    "wenix": 815,
}